From 1e08545bd94e1dca7901e01d5c296dbd5c0bc8a0 Mon Sep 17 00:00:00 2001 From: Cal Corum Date: Mon, 9 Mar 2026 10:47:42 -0500 Subject: [PATCH] fix: use nested opener_team object from scout_opportunity response The API returns opener_team as a full nested object, not an ID. No need to fetch it separately. Co-Authored-By: Claude Opus 4.6 --- cogs/admins.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/cogs/admins.py b/cogs/admins.py index 0ce2350..11d9260 100644 --- a/cogs/admins.py +++ b/cogs/admins.py @@ -755,8 +755,8 @@ class Admins(commands.Cog): ) return - # Fetch opener team - opener_team = await db_get(f"teams/{scout_opp['opener_team']}") + # Get opener team (API returns it as a nested object) + opener_team = scout_opp.get("opener_team") if not opener_team: await interaction.followup.send( "Could not fetch opener team.", ephemeral=True